Almost 90% of farms in America are classified as small farms, and nearly all of them are family-owned. These are the backbone of our food supply chain, and they are in trouble.

The 2022 Census of shows 141,000 farms went out of business in a five-year period, and we’ve lost even more since the report was released. The Farm Bureau has submitted a letter to USDA outlining policy recommendations that support small producers. Here’s what they’re calling for:

- Improvements to USDA farm programs like Title I safety net programs and ad hoc disaster programs.

- More and enhanced options for risk management.

- Reforming regulations that create complex and expensive compliance burdens.

- Creating a workforce solution that gives all farmers access to labor.

The USDA’s plan includes streamlining application processes, improving reliable access to credit, , and markets, and providing appropriate business planning tools.
